Well hello everyone, and welcome to Puggs first closet grow. In my 2x3 closet I am growing 2 photoperiod plants.. an Early Miss from clone as well as a Critical+ 2.0 from clone both are in 3.5 gallon pots. Then right in the middle of those is a 2.2 gallon pot that is home to the Auto Thunder Bloody Mary which I pants from seed.

These plants are all being grown under a 450w full spectrum LED from viparspectra and I am running both veg and bloom switch all the way through on an 18/6 light schedule. I will continue this schedule untill my autoflower has finished flower. I will then switch to a 12/12 schedule after a few weeks of adjusting the canopies on both photos.

I first transplanted each clone into 3.5 gallon pots using Promix the extra perlite bag. I amended the medium using Gaia Green 2-8-4 , 4-4-4 and a generous amount of worm castings. I did this on december 18th 2018 and so far that has served the plants well.

As for my auto thunder bloody mary I germinated the seed directly into my amended medium in a 2.2 gallon pot on december 15th and used the top of a dr pepper 2L bottle and some plastic wrap to act as a humidity dome to promote the germination. This seed sprouted in just over 2 days as I noticed it early december 18th and seems as if it grew faster each and every day..

It is now January 11 2019 all of my plants are currently in veg but my autoflower is expected to start a viscous flower cycle in the comming days which I am very much looking forward to. I have a 6 inch fan blowing air through each plant with a 4 inch exhaust fan which I found on amazon pulling the hot humid air out at the top of my closet .. the temp tends to drop to about 68 during lights off to 75 when lights are on. I use a Honeywell cool mist humidifier to keep the RH between 50-60 but sometimes it rises to the 70's in which case I will adjust ..

EARLY MISS CLONE - when I received this clone it was not doing great at all.. it had mutated growth with rounded leaves and was not branching off and seemed as if it was starting to flower just a few weeks in .. something was wrong and with it being my first grow I had no clue what to do.. so I chopped all of the growth off minutes the very top leaf so it had a way to get the light. After a few days in it's new environment it started to grow new happy vibrant leaves so I trimmed all of the remaining growth that was ugly and mutated and since then it is growing like a new plant.
This plant is currently on day number 25 in my closet and growing very healthy now

Critical+ 2.0 clone - this clone was just starting to get root bound when I had transplanted it into my amended medium. It rooted very fast and I was able to trim the bottomed yellowing growth off on its second day in my closet which proved beneficial as over the next few days this plant grew faster and faster untill I topped her on december 24th 2018 to which she showed no signs of needing to recover.. it was almost instant she just kept growing and growing.. this plant is a monster and has now been topped twice.. I am now hoping to try to bush her out and work on the canopy in the comming weeks. This plant is currently also in day 25 of being in my closet.

Auto Thunder Bloody Mary - this autoflower seed was a complimentary seed that came with my order of 5 purple gorilla autoflower seeds which I will be growing next. This plant has not stopped.. it is just about caught up to my critical+ 2.0 in height and I has began LST to even out the canopy as much as possible as she is supposed to begin flower any day now.. what a smelly plany during veg. I'm quite excited as this will be my first ever harvest and also it will allow me to turn the light cycle over to flower my clones . This autoflower is currently on day 25 since being planted directly into the amended medium.

We are now at day 29 since my autoflower seed sprouted and I must say it has not looked back .. I've been lsting her for almost a week now and the canopy is slowly but surely going to even out as she is going to be in full flower very soon.. and already smells wonderful. (There is one fan leaf that has developed some rust spots.. I've opted to leave it because I'm not sure if it will affect growth if I cut it.. )

As for both clones they are both just filling up the space.. I must say I am a bit overwhelmed with how thick and bushy the critical+ 2.0 is getting while still stretching out .. I havent noticed any problems with this plant whatsoever since transplanting into my amended soil and putting her in her final home ..

The early miss on the left side is also growing well now. Although I did just have to top dress her .. she was showing rust spots on a few leaves I trimmed the ugly growth off and she seems to be doing well

All in all just super excited for flowering on my autoflower because as soon as she is done I can truly let my big girls grow and flip them to flower shortly after..

I have had my first problems occur during late week 3.. with some tips going yellow on new growth as well as rust spots appearing on 2 of 3 plants.. I think it was a ph problem as I have adjusted back to 6.6 but I did lazily use 6.3 beginning of week 3 and next day noticed deficiencies.. but nothing new since adjusting the ph ..

Wow sorry for not updating recently guys.. here are some shots of my closet/mini jungle as we get through day 40 since planting my auto and re homing my clones.

Early miss - has grown out like crazy I had to tie her down and she just keeps shooting new stems out.. what a monster she is ..

Critical+ 2.0 - just a beauty .. she has required no maintenance in comparison to my other girls.. and keeps bushing out.. I'm very excited to let these girls fill out the closet in a few weeks when my auto is finished.. I have also tied this girl down in order to let my flowering auto take the good lighting..

Auto thunder bloody mary - growing amazingly.. double digit bud sights and just fdoesnt stop showing new ones.. she is in week 2 or 3 of flower now showing long white hairs and getting the nice buildup on the leaves.. with a very nice smell.. I love it and cant wait for the finished product in a few weeks..

I will be top dressing both the critical+ 2.0 and the auto thunder bloody mary in the comming week .. using a blend of 2-8-4 and 4-4-4 with worm castings all from gaia green .. I have not fed since amending the soil prior to planting ..
I top dressed the early miss on day 30 because I fed her les when I amended the soil as I wasnt sure what my plans for her were and she started showing deficiencies.. all in all everything is looking great and healthy and I will post more photos on my page
